    • RE: IH-1955S-142od - 14oz Selvedge Denim "1955" Vintage Tapered Jeans - Indigo Overdyed Black

      @harleylawhorn said in IH-1955S-142od - 14oz Selvedge Denim "1955" Vintage Tapered Jeans - Indigo Overdyed Black:

      Would you say that I could get away with a 31.9 (size 32) if I currently have a well fitting 634s that’s sized 32.5 since these have a higher rise?

      Assuming that your 634 measure 32.5 the way we measure, now, after wear and not immediatley after a wash, then your safe tolerance for another pair of similar fitting jeans (based on waist alone, clearly - i cannot assess how the leg would fit from the info provided) would be 31.5-32.0. This would allow them to stretch to about the same size.

      If you are saying that you have a pair of 634S that measured 32.5 at the time of purchase, then the math is slightly different.

      In my experience, the average customer has a slightly narrower "waist" at the point that the 1955 is designed to sit than the 634, which would support you fitting on the smaller end of the bracket i gave - so yes, I would predict that size would work for you.
